      What the above verse has pointed to; is an excellent plan for the settlement of family jars and disputes, and it has several advantages over the ordinary judicial courts as follows:

      1- In the family circle, application of legal trickeries of law which is the object of usual judicial courts will not prove effective and efficient. Therefore the verse shows a new way for the settlement of disputes between the couple: ``Appoint an arbiter from his people and an arbiter from her family.'' The arbitration has proved to be the most effective plan, but unfortunately Muslims do not resort to it universally, as they should! It is evident that the arbiter from each family knows more of the personal mannerism and pecularities of both parties, and more chance and ability, if God speeds, to settle, disputes and establish a real reconciliation.

      2- In the ordinary judicial courts, the parties have to disclose their secrets in the sight of not closely personal and intimates in order to defend. Then such exposure of the secrets of marriage and intercourses of the couple to the eye of a stranger, may injure the emotions and feeling of the spouses, so much so that when they return reconciled, they find their previous sincerity and former kindness entirely impaired and diminished!

      3- Almost all the judges in the common judicial courts, are indifferent to the fate and ultimate lot of the judged. In fact they are neither for, nor against the one upon whom their judgement is. On the other hand the family arbiters are willing, and will to their best, to reconcile and reunite the couple and encourage them earnestly to live a peaceful life.

      4- After all, such a family court has neither the expenses nor the complications and confusions of the ordinary judicial courts.
